Convection demo without Potassium Permanganate
This is a good demo since it does not need chemicals and it can be portable. The slight problem is that it needs reduced room illumination except if you used a very bright light source.
Basically you need a clear container such as small fish tank or unmarked
1 litre beaker. A 6V battery. Two leads and a 5 cm length of resistance wire.
All you are doing is heating the wire in the clear plastic tank. this will give convection currents which you can see as shadows on a screen if you shine a bright light through it.
A halogen bulb in a torch, a 12V halogen bulb and PSU or an OHP could all be used as light sources.
